Tip 1: Forget Mastery First, Get the Curse (Seriously!)

Then I read something somewhere: Amplify Damage is your real friend early on. So after struggling through the Blood Moor for way too long, I listened. Next point? Slammed it into Amplify Damage. Used it on the next pack of Fallen. Holy sht! My puny skeletons shredded them! It was night and day. Instead of my skeletons just bouncing off enemies, stuff started actually dying fast. My clear speed got so much better. I felt like an idiot wasting points on Mastery early.

Tip 4: Skills: Skeleton First, Warrior Second, Rest Later

So I had my curse, I had my bodies, I had my merc. Now for skill points. Ditched the Mastery-first plan completely. Followed the simple path:

  • Max Raise Skeleton: More bodies = bigger army. Every point here meant 1 more dude swinging a rusty weapon. Put points here whenever possible. Bigger mob = faster clears.
  • Then Max Skeleton Mastery: Once the Raise Skeleton count was high, then I started pouring points here. Suddenly my paper skeletons turned into cardboard ones! Still flimsy, but they lasted way longer.
  • Skeletal Mages? Nope. Tried one point early. Looked cool, shot frost bolts. Did squat for damage. Useless. Wasted corpse. Never bothered again.
  • Clay Golem: One point is enough. Slow guy, but good distraction. Toss him out, let the merc do the real corpse work.

Felt super simple. No fancy tactics.

Tip 5: Stats? Keep it Stupid Simple

My first Necro, years ago? I messed up stats bad. This time? Followed the KISS principle:

  • Strength: Nope. Only enough for gear, which is almost nothing until way later. Skipped it mostly.
  • Dexterity: Ignored it. Not hitting things myself.
  • Energy: Forget it. Mana pots are stupid cheap. Drank them constantly.
  • Vitality: Dump every single point here. Every level up? “Click, Vitality.” Stayed alive way easier.

Played safe behind my giant bone wall. Needed health way more than anything else.
